What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an ITSM Manager?

To thrive as an ITSM Manager, you need expertise in IT service management frameworks (such as ITIL), experience with process improvement, and a strong understanding of IT operations, often supported by a relevant degree and ITIL certification. Familiarity with ITSM platforms like ServiceNow, BMC Remedy, or Jira Service Management is typically required. Strong le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ills set exceptional ITSM Managers apart by enabling them to drive change and coordinate cross-functional teams. These skills are vital for ensuring efficient IT service delivery, continuous improvement, and alignment with organizational goals.

What are the primary challenges an ITSM Manager faces when implementing new IT service processes across a large organization?

An ITSM Manager often encounters challenges such as resistance to change from staff, ensuring effective communication between IT and other business units, and aligning new processes with existing technology and workflows. Managing stakeholder expectations and providing adequate training are crucial to gaining buy-in and ensuring smooth adoption. Additionally, balancing the need for standardization with the flexibility required by different departments can be complex, requiring strong leadership and problem-solving skills.

What does an ITSM Manager do?

An ITSM (IT Service Management) Manager oversees the processes and teams that deliver IT services within an organization. They ensure that IT services are aligned with business needs, manage incident and problem resolution, and work to improve the quality and efficiency of IT operations. Responsibilities often include developing ITSM policies, monitoring service delivery performance, and leading service improvement initiatives. The ITSM Manager acts as a bridge between IT and other business units to support smooth operations and customer satisfaction.

What is the difference between Itsm Manager vs Service Desk Manager?

AspectItsm ManagerService Desk Manager
Primary FocusOversees IT service management processes, ensuring efficient delivery and complianceManages daily service desk operations, customer support, and incident resolution
CertificationsITIL, COBIT, PMP often preferredITIL, HDI certifications common
Work EnvironmentStrategic, process-oriented, cross-departmentalOperational, customer-facing, team management
Industry UsageIT service providers, large enterprisesIT support centers, corporate IT departments

While both roles focus on IT service delivery, the Itsm Manager has a broader, process-driven role overseeing overall IT service management strategies. The Service Desk Manager concentrates on daily support operations and customer interactions. Understanding these differences helps in choosing the right career path or job focus.
